5-(Chloromethyl)-1,3-thiazole, HCl

    Specifications

    HS Code

    959529

    Chemical Formula C4H5Cl2NS
    Molecular Weight 168.06 g/mol
    Appearance Solid (usually white or off - white)
    Solubility Soluble in polar solvents like DMSO, methanol
    Melting Point Typically in a certain range, e.g., around 150 - 170°C
    Boiling Point Decomposes before boiling under normal pressure
    Odor May have a pungent odor
    Stability Stable under normal storage conditions, but may react with strong oxidizing agents
    Hazard Class Irritant, may cause skin, eye and respiratory tract irritation

    What is the synthesis method of 5- (Chloromethyl) -1,3-thiazole, HCl?
    To prepare 5- (chloromethyl) -1,3 -thiazole hydrochloride, the following method can be used.
    First take a suitable starting material, if the sulfur-containing and nitrogen-containing compounds are used as starting materials, such as a sulfur-containing heterocyclic precursor with halomethylation reagents. In a suitable reaction vessel, add an organic solvent, which must have good solubility to the reactants and do not interfere with the reaction, such as dichloromethane and other halogenated hydrocarbon solvents.
    Put the starting material into the solvent in a certain proportion, stir well, and make the system well mixed. Slowly add halomethylating reagents, such as chloromethylating reagents (such as chloromethyl methyl ether, etc., which need to be carefully selected according to the reaction conditions and substrate activity). During this process, the reaction temperature is strictly controlled. Due to the great influence of temperature on the reaction process and product selectivity, it can generally be maintained in the range of low temperature to room temperature, and can be precisely regulated by ice bath or water bath.
    During the reaction process, closely monitor the reaction progress, which can be observed by means of thin-layer chromatography (TLC). When the reaction reaches the expected level, the reaction is terminated. At this time, the reaction system may contain the target product and various impurities.
    The reaction mixture is preliminarily treated, such as washing with an appropriate alkali solution (such as sodium bicarbonate solution, etc.) to remove acidic impurities and collect the organic phase in separation. After that, the organic phase is dried with a desiccant (such as anhydrous sodium sulfate, etc.), and the desiccant is filtered out to obtain a preliminary purified organic solution.
    To obtain the target product 5- (chloromethyl) -1,3-thiazole hydrochloride, dry hydrogen chloride gas can be introduced into the above organic solution to promote the precipitation of the target product into hydrochloride. After suction filtration, washing, drying, etc., a relatively pure 5- (chloromethyl) -1,3-thiazole hydrochloride product can be obtained. During the whole process, attention should be paid to the standardization of operation and the precise control of reaction conditions to improve the yield and purity of the product.
    5- (Chloromethyl) -1,3-thiazole, HCl What are the precautions when storing
    5 - (chloromethyl) -1,3 -thiazole hydrochloride, this is a chemical substance. When storing it, many things need to be paid attention to.
    Bear the brunt, temperature and humidity are the key. It should be stored in a cool and dry place. Due to high temperature, or chemical reactions such as thermal decomposition of substances, which affect its purity and stability; if the humidity is too high, the substance may be damp and cause adverse changes such as hydrolysis. Therefore, it is necessary to avoid humid places or place desiccants in storage to maintain a dry environment.
    Secondly, pay attention to avoiding light. Many chemical substances are prone to photochemical reactions when exposed to light, and 5- (chloromethyl) -1,3-thiazole hydrochloride may be no exception. Strong light irradiation may change its chemical structure and reduce quality, so it should be stored in dark containers such as brown bottles.
    Furthermore, isolation is essential. This substance should not be mixed with oxidizing agents, reducing agents, alkalis and other substances, because of its active chemical properties, contact with the above substances, or severe chemical reactions, such as redox reactions, acid-base neutralization reactions, etc., or serious consequences such as fire and explosion.
    In addition, the storage place must be well ventilated. If the substance evaporates to produce harmful gases, good ventilation can be discharged in time to reduce the concentration of harmful gases in the air, ensure the safety of the storage environment, and prevent poisoning and other hazards caused by the accumulation of harmful gases.
    Finally, the storage area should be clearly marked, marked with the name of the substance, characteristics, storage precautions, etc., so that the staff can clearly, access and management are more convenient, and at the same time, it can also prevent the danger caused by misoperation. In this way, the 5- (chloromethyl) -1,3-thiazole hydrochloride can be properly stored to ensure its quality and safety.
